Appropriate Preposition:

  • Grateful for ( কৃতজ্ঞ (কোনকিছু) ) I am grateful to you for your help.
  • Prone to ( ঝোঁক আছে এমন ) He is prone to idleness.
  • Deaf to ( শুনতে অনিচ্ছুক ) He is deaf to my request.
  • Commence on ( শুরু করা ) Our examination commences on the 3rd July.
  • Entitled to ( অধিকারী ) He is entitled to a reward for his honesty.
  • Inquire of ( অনুসন্ধান করা (ব্যক্তি) ) I inquired of him about the matter.

Idioms:

  • put a spoke to ones wheel ( কারও উন্নতিতে বাধা হওয়া )
  • Bosom friend ( অন্তরঙ্গ বন্ধু ) Rifat is my bosom friend.
  • bunch of fives ( মুষ্টি ; পাঁচ আঙ্গুলের মুঠো ) Rock can break anything with his bunch of fives.
  • Black sheep ( কুলাঙ্গার ) He is a black sheep in his family.
  • Weal and woe ( সুখ-দুঃখ ) Human life is full of weal and woe.
  • hold your horses ( সবুর করা ; ধৈর্য ধরা ) Hold your horses in trouble, you will get your reward.
